  • The Salvation Army ordains women and has done since its inception. Catherine Booth was co-founder, with her husband William.
  • The Church of the Nazarene ordains women, with the first women being ordained since 1908.[citation needed]
  • The Wesleyan Methodist Church (which is now the Allegheny Wesleyan Methodist Connection and Wesleyan Church) has ordained women as ministers since near its inception, and claims to be one of the first to ordain women in the modern era.[10]
